Comic Description
Part of the 'Eight Against a World!' storyline. Han Solo and Chewbacca assemble a band of misfits (The Star-Hoppers) to defend the village of Aduba-3 from local raiders and the Cloud-Riders. This issue features the first appearance of the iconic green-furred rabbit Jaxxon.

Notable Features
First appearance of Jaxxon (Lepi smuggler) and the Star-Hoppers. This is the blank UPC variant (Direct Edition). This issue marks the period where Marvel began original stories beyond the 'A New Hope' film adaptation.
